What is the Age Pension?

The Age Pension is a government economic gain furnished to Australian residents aged 67 years or older who meet certain residency, profits, and belongings criteria. This pension is supposed to ensure older residents a basic policy of residing on their retirement.

This pension is re-evaluated and adjusted twice a year, commonly in March and September, based on adjustments in inflation and the cost of living.

Eligibility criteria for Age Pension in 2025

To receive the Age Pension, individuals must meet the following requirements:

Age requirement:

  • The applicant must be at least 67 years old in 2025.

Residence status:

  • The applicant must be an Australian citizen or permanent resident.
  • They must have lived in Australia for at least 10 years, including 5 consecutive years.

Income test:

  • The Age Pension undergoes an income test, which limits how much you can earn before your pension is reduced. The income limits for 2025 will be as follows:
  • Singles: Can earn up to $204 per fortnight before the pension is reduced. For every $1 above this limit, the pension will be reduced by 50 cents.
  • Couples (joint): Can earn up to $360 per fortnight before the pension is reduced.

Assets test:

  • The assets test limits how much property you can own (excluding your main home). The asset limits for 2025 will be as follows:
  • Single homeowner: Up to $301,750
  • Couple homeowner (joint): Up to $451,500
  • Single non-homeowner: Up to $543,750
  • Couple non-homeowner (joint): Up to $693,500

If your income or assets exceed these limits, your pension may be reduced or may not be available.

How to apply for the $841 Age Pension increase and $21 bonus?

Eligible individuals can apply for the Age Pension in the following ways:

Apply online:

  • Go to myGov and link your Centrelink account, then apply online.

Apply by phone:

  • Call 13 23 00 for phone assistance.

In-person application:

  • Visit your nearest Services Australia service center with the required documents.

Documents required for application:

  • Proof of identity (e.g., passport, driving license)
  • Income and asset statements
  • Residence details
